How to Know If Your Pet Dog Suches As Childcare
Pets that appreciate childcare reveal a variety of signs. One clear sign is when your pup excitedly runs right into the center and welcomes personnel with their tail wagging.


When your dog licks you or shows affection in the direction of you it is additionally an excellent indication. The licking releases endorphins that make the communication pleasant for both of you!

Arrival Reaction
When your pet is delighted, wagging their tail and drawing you towards the daycare entrance it reveals that they connect going to childcare with enjoyable and positive experiences. It also indicates that they are an excellent suitable for the day care atmosphere and that they are sociable with various other pet dogs and people.

Once inside the childcare center they will be relaxed and satisfied to see you. They must be eager to head into the back areas where their close friends are. They must not be tense or clingy as this may indicate that they are burnt out and need to go home.

Dogs that are clingy upon arrival can suggest that they are not playing or have been crated most of their time while at childcare and are not getting enough communication with other dogs. Conversely, if they are as well exhausted on arrival it might indicate that they played hard all the time and were not allowed to relax and work out into their regular nesting routine which can trigger them to be overtired.

Body Language
If your pet is thrilled to go to childcare, wagging their tail and drawing you toward the structure, this is a strong indicator that they connect daycare with good ideas. This is a clear indicator that they enjoy prancing with their buddies at daycare and eagerly anticipate it each time.

On the other hand, if your dog appears nervous or distressed when you drop them off at daycare, this can be a solid indication that they do not appreciate the experience. They may hold on to you or hang back when come close to by staff members, and they might display a stressful body stance.

When you come to get your canine, their responses can also inform a lot concerning whether they enjoyed their day at the childcare in Indio. If they appear unwinded and satisfied to see you, they likely had an excellent day. If they seem overtired or burnt out, it could be an indicator that they were not well-matched with other pets and did not get enough playtime.

Actions
Pet dogs that like daycare are commonly excited to arrive and will rush towards the center entrance with a wagging tail. They will have the ability to run and play with their friends, which is terrific for socializing. They will additionally be psychologically and physically promoted, which can reduce harmful actions in your home.

On the other hand, pets who do not take pleasure in daycare might be reluctant to go into and will emit signals of anxiety and stress and anxiety. They might be clingy, barking or hiding in their kennel when they arrive home, which is bad for them or the various other canines.

In a similar way, giant breeds that come to day care may have problem having fun with other pets because they are typically a lot larger than the other animals and are not trained for borders and obedience. In this situation, the childcare may have to reject the pet. This can be a frustrating adjustment for the proprietor but it is constantly best to place the dog's health and wellness first.
